Output 893b095581e3ead63c394bf11f39dda1e21c031ea06155768c1a94060ed98376:0

value
760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26cd32bb377180fead02fa6d7d236d889931046c OP_EQUAL
address
35EBRFaAcNpfVPBLayEUYpwo5ZraAUuH8B
transaction
893b095581e3ead63c394bf11f39dda1e21c031ea06155768c1a94060ed98376